To put drywall anchors in a wall effectively, first choose the right anchor size for your project. Use a drill to create a hole in the wall where you want to place the anchor. Insert the anchor into the hole and gently tap it in with a hammer. Finally, screw in the screw or hook into the anchor until it is secure.

Use Anchors When Hanging LED TVs ?

You cannot just hang LED TVs on the wall with screws alone. The screws will pull out of the drywall and the television will fall to the ground. To keep this from happening, you need to use wall anchors instead. These are made of plastic, and you can put them into the drywall. You can then put the screws into the anchors. This will make sure that the weight of the television does not cause it to fall.

How can I effectively put wall anchors in plaster walls?

To effectively put wall anchors in plaster walls, start by drilling a small pilot hole with a drill bit slightly smaller than the anchor. Insert the anchor into the hole and gently tap it in with a hammer. Use a screwdriver to tighten the screw into the anchor, securing it in place. Be careful not to overtighten, as this can damage the plaster.

How to put tile on drywall effectively?

To put tile on drywall effectively, follow these steps: Prepare the drywall surface by sanding and cleaning it. Apply a waterproofing membrane or primer to the drywall. Use thin-set mortar to adhere the tiles to the drywall. Use spacers to ensure even spacing between tiles. Allow the mortar to dry completely before grouting the tiles. Seal the grout to protect it from moisture and stains.


When building a wall do you put Spackle on before the tape or after?

You don't put 'spackle' on at all. After taping the drywall seams you 'mud' them with drywall compound. -It is a totally different substance from 'spackle', which should be used only to fill small holes and irregularities in wall.
